One of your php files has a "byte order mark" (BOM) at the beginning. That happens sometimes when certain programs are used to edit the file. A lot of times it's config.php that has the problem. You should use a programming editor (such as notepad++, which is free), and edit a new copy. If you use notepad++, you can also use the "Encoding" menu to fix the problem in the current file so you don't have to start over.
